- [ ] Step 7: Archive cold storage buckets (Glacierline tier). Confirm both ceremony witnesses are present, verify bucket manifests match the Oxbow ledger, then seal the archive key shares. Plugin authors may observe but not handle shares. Once sealed, the archive index itself is encrypted and can only be reopened with the passphrase below.

vault phrase of badup-hahig = tamael-aldael-kelmir-istael-fenok-istwyn-tamius-jorath-oliion

The Fernhollow transcoding farm runs in three environments: dev, staging, and production, each in an isolated network segment. Worker nodes pull jobs from the Quarrel queue and never accept inbound connections; all media ingress goes through the staging proxy tier. For this security review, note that credentials are injected at boot via the vault sidecar and rotate daily, and no secrets are baked into worker images. The production worker tier currently runs with the following configuration values.

deployment values, yadup-kadug:
[sorys]
port = 5672
team = noveth
host = sorys.orvexcorp.example
region = south-4
access_code = ac_deddc1
timeout_ms = 1500

MEMO — Kettling Depot Receiving

Uniform sets for the new Kettling depot arrive Wednesday via Ashgrove courier: 40 boxes, sorted by size, manifest attached to box one. Check the count at the dock before signing; shortages go straight to stores, not the courier. The hand-over instruction the courier will follow is set out below.

drop instructions, tafof-baguf: the holmir gilox courier leaves the sormir ulaok holdor ledger at gate 5596 under passcode 257343